Watch a fascinating 17-minute video demonstration where a vintage PDP-11/83 computer is used to build and deploy the 2.11 BSD Unix Kernel from original sources. Follow along as the intricate process of kernel compilation and deployment is explained on classic hardware, offering unique insights into early Unix development and computer architecture. Learn about the challenges and complexities involved in working with historical operating systems and hardware, making this an educational journey through computing history.
